I’m writing this review after more than three years in this workspace, a place I genuinely loved and recommended to countless people. The physical space is amazing, and for a long time, the experience matched it (mark from front desk rocks). Unfortunately, everything changed when new management took over, and it became a completely different environment almost overnight. This isn’t just my personal experience. I know many long-term tenants who left for the exact same reasons, which is why I feel compelled to share this and hopefully save others from going through what we did. The new management is extremely hostile and unnecessarily difficult to work with. One example: after three and a half years of being reliable, respectful tenants, we were suddenly asked to move offices (so they could rent our space to another tenant who would pay more) even though nothing in our lease required that. We agreed anyway, just to be helpful. Just weeks after we moved, we were given only five days’ notice before our lease renewal that the rent was being doubled- again with zero prior discussion. And it didn’t stop there. On the very last day of our lease — a day we had fully paid for — I went back to pick up an item and found that our access had already been cut off early. I was told I could only come during certain hours when management was present, despite the fact that we legally still had the right to access the space for the entire day. It was completely unnecessary, petty, and honestly shocking after years of being good tenants. The space itself is great, but there are plenty of other workspaces in the city that don’t come with hostile, erratic management. I would strongly recommend choosing one of those instead. This experience was disappointing, stressful, and absolutely not worth it.

  • For spontaneous collaboration and interaction, open desks provide an open and flexible environment. If you prefer a dedicated space with shared community elements, dedicated desks offer a great balance between personal space and interaction.

    On the other hand, private offices are best suited for focused work and private interactions. They're ideal for solo workers as well as teams seeking a dedicated space, shielded from distractions.

    Choosing the ideal coworking arrangement for you is about aligning your workspace with your work style, team dynamics, and project requirements.
